Constituency-To Use or Not to Use?
I think a large part of the reason that we refer to our esteemed group of church as a constituency is because we feel have no other option. The other words to call a group of churches would include the following:
- Denomination
- Conference
- Confederation
- Connection
- Fellowship
- Movement
We do not consider ourselves a denomination, because we are a loose affiliation of churches without any central form of government whatsoever.
A Beachy church is a Beachy church only because all the other Beachy churches accept them as such. There is no comprehensive list of Beachy churches, although everyone in the constituency, denomination, conference, confederation, connection, confederation (take your pick) knows who’s who.
Because of the loose connections between our churches, the terms denomination and conference do not seem suitable to describe our Beachy you-know-what.
Confederation might be a plausible possibility, but because, like constituency, it has political overtones, it seems unsuitable for our politically uninvolved group.
Connection is a traditionally Methodist term, and therefore is unsuitable for use as well, especially since its definition implies central goverment. (Not that I have a problem with Methodists, I go to a Wesleyan Methodist college.)
Finally, we have the term fellowship. This term implies that we have have warm relations between all the churches in the Beachy ______. Fill in the blank.
Movement implies that we are going somewhere. Enough said.
